What Is Cleavers Weed. Learn how to identify, forage, harvest, and use the common weed called cleavers. Sticky weed is an annual plant that belongs to the rubiaceae family. Galium aparine is commonly referred to as cleavers, goosegrass, catchweed, sticky willy or bedstraw, among other names. Galium aparine, or cleavers, is the type of weed that is probably already stuck to you before you even take notice of it. However, this common weed is also a surprisingly versatile wild edible. Cleavers (galium aparine) is a widely found spring weed that you’re likely to find. It is native to north america, europe, and asia but has spread to other parts of the world. Explore the comprehensive guide to identifying, using, harvesting, and preparing cleavers (galium aparine). Cleavers is best used as a nourishing herbal infusion. Cleavers earned its name thanks to the sticky plant’s tendency to ‘cleave’ to human clothing or animal fur.
